Technical Field

The invention relates to an operating tool, in particular to a gas glasses valve operating tool with a warning and monitoring function, and belongs to the technical field of gas operation control.

Background

Many iron and steel enterprises are self-contained in power plants, and the ignition fuel of a boiler is coke oven gas which is a coking byproduct. According to the regulation of GB6222 'gas safety regulations of industrial enterprises', the butterfly valve can not be used as a reliable partition device, and can be used as a reliable partition device in a gas medium pipeline after being used together with a glasses valve. Therefore, the glasses valve is required to be operated when coke oven gas is introduced for boiler ignition or the coke oven gas is shut down and isolated. At present, the glasses valve mainly comprises a manual glasses valve, an electric glasses valve, a hydraulic glasses valve, a closed gate valve and the like, and has various characteristics.

The main fuel of the gas boiler of the self-contained power plant of the iron and steel enterprise is blast furnace gas, the coke furnace gas is used for ignition and safe and stable combustion, the diameter of a main pipe of the coke furnace gas in front of the gas boiler is not large, and the total amount of the blast furnace gas which can be used for burning the self-contained power plant gas boiler with load can be greatly changed at any time along with the changes of the production plan of the iron-making blast furnace and the usage amount of the blast furnace gas in other smelting processes, so that the load reduction and the furnace shutdown of the gas boiler of the self-contained power plant and the ignition of the coke furnace gas in a short time are caused, and the operation times of coke furnace gas glasses valves are very large.

Because the coke oven gas glasses valve of the gas boiler of the self-contained power plant of the iron and steel enterprises has very many times of operation (10-20 times of the operation frequency of the glasses valve of the common gas pipeline), the frequent operation causes the service life of the electric glasses valve, the hydraulic glasses valve and the closed gate valve to be greatly shortened, the failure rate to be increased and the electric glasses valve, the hydraulic glasses valve and the closed gate valve not to be suitable for the frequent operation rhythm, so the small-pipe-diameter manual glasses valve with small failure rate and strong operation compatibility is greatly used in the enterprises. However, the problems of the operation speed of the manual glasses valve and the warning and monitoring of the gas area operation still exist, so that a tool which can be operated more quickly and can simultaneously solve the warning and monitoring of the gas area is urgently invented.

Disclosure of Invention

The invention provides a gas glasses valve operating tool with a warning and monitoring function aiming at the problems in the prior art, and the technical scheme promotes the gas operation to be rapid, efficient and safe and controllable in process.

In order to achieve the purpose, the technical scheme of the invention is that the gas glasses valve operating tool with the warning and monitoring functions comprises a T-shaped stress application rod, a glasses valve body, a fixing pin and a safety monitoring system, one end of the T-shaped stress application rod is fixed with a glasses valve tightening bolt, the other end of the T-shaped stress application rod serves as a new operating end, the operating angle of the new operating end is increased, two ends of the new operating tool can be operated and inserted into the operating end of the T-shaped stress application rod, the gas glasses valve tightening bolt can be operated, two ends of the operating tool are provided with triangular key structures, and nitrogen purging replacement operation can be performed behind an operating box on the outer side of a ball valve for purging nitrogen when a coke oven gas pipeline is opened.

As an improvement of the invention, the novel operating tool is provided with two pin holes for customizing and placing the operating tool at a designated position; the tool is painted with red and white paint, and is a safety warning object when placed in a fixed position. Furthermore, the operating tool is fixed on the pin through the pin hole, the fixing pin is arranged as an end head of the miniature gravity sensor, and the fixing pin bears pressure through the metal flat washer in the middle section of the end head.

As an improvement of the invention, a buckle is arranged beside each fixed pin, and the operation tool can be taken down and the operation link can be entered only by opening the buckle after multiple verification of the safety monitoring system.

As an improvement of the invention, the safety monitoring system comprises a fingerprint machine, a voice broadcaster, a gravity sensor signal box, a temperature hygrometer, a rainwater sensor, a wind anemoscope and a remote computer, wherein the fingerprint machine records fingerprint information and job numbers of all personnel with gas operation qualification, the remote computer records the job numbers of the gas operation personnel and the information of the personnel operating in shift, four fixing pins are arranged, the four fixing pins are connected with the gravity sensor signal box, a multichannel analog transmitter in the gravity sensor signal box converts mV differential signals of the sensor into 4-20mA output analog signals, and then data are uploaded through an RS485/RS232 interface; the temperature and humidity meter is composed of a thermometer and a humidity meter, the rainwater sensor is made of a double-sided material, plated with nickel on the surface, resistant to oxidation and electricity, and outputs and detects whether rain exists or not by adopting a DO TTL switch signal: when no raindrop exists on the induction plate, the DO output is high level, when raindrop exists, the DO output is low level, and the rain sensor and the humidity condition in the temperature and humidity meter jointly judge whether the weather is rainy or not.

As an improvement of the invention, the new glasses valve operating tool is made of brass, no spark is generated when the tool is contacted with an iron pipe valve during operation, one side of each of two ends of the operating tool is bent inwards by 30 degrees, the other side of each of the two ends of the operating tool is bent outwards by 30 degrees, and the operation of loosening and tightening bolts of the glasses valve can be carried out by inserting any one end of the operating tool into a pipe of the T-shaped stress application rod.

As an improvement of the invention, the T-shaped stress application rod is formed by welding two sections of stainless steel tubes, three sets of T-shaped stress application rods are needed after full welding forming, and the T-shaped stress application rods are respectively connected with the elastic bolts by adopting a hot expansion method to form a new operation end.

As an improvement of the invention, the T-shaped stress application rod is of a T-shaped structure, and the operation angle is increased to 360 degrees when the T-shaped stress application rod is matched with a new operation tool for use.

Compared with the prior art, the invention has the following advantages: 1) the scheme avoids the defects of frequent alignment and small operation angle during the operation of the traditional tool, improves the operation efficiency of the gas glasses valve, and reduces the operation short plate to the minimum; 2) the scheme simultaneously utilizes the software constraint function and the hardware constraint function to enable the operation tool to be positioned and placed, thereby reducing the preparation time before gas operation and the management problem of later-stage tools and appliances; 3) the scheme does not need to additionally arrange a field warning object or a key for blowing and replacing the gas valve protection box, and has multiple functions and special purpose; 4) the scheme solves the problem that the qualification discrimination and the shift discrimination of gas operators in special operation are realized at one time, and simultaneously, the safety regulation is matched to ensure that the gas operation is 2 or more people; 5) the scheme ingeniously avoids the condition of illegal operation of high-temperature operation and rainy day operation; 6) the scheme better realizes the one-time storage, recording and printing of the gas operation information (operator, time, environmental temperature, wind direction and wind power, violation information and the like).

The specific implementation mode is as follows:

for the purpose of enhancing an understanding of the present invention, the present embodiment will be described in detail below with reference to the accompanying drawings.

Example 1: referring to fig. 1, a gas glasses valve operation tool with warning and monitoring functions comprises a T-shaped force applying rod, a glasses valve body 2, a fixing pin 6 and a safety monitoring system, wherein one end of the T-shaped force applying rod is fixed with a glasses valve tightening bolt, the other end of the T-shaped force applying rod is used as a new operation end, the operation angle of the new operation end is increased, two ends of the new operation tool can be operated and inserted into the operation end of the T-shaped force applying rod, so that the gas eye valve tightening bolt operation can be performed, two ends of the operation tool are provided with triangular key structures, nitrogen purging and replacement operations can be performed after an operation box outside a ball valve for purging nitrogen on a coke gas pipeline is opened, and the new operation tool is provided with two pin holes for customizing and placing the operation tool at a designated position; the tool is painted with red and white paint, and is a safety warning object when placed in a fixed position. Furthermore, the operation tool is fixed on the pins through the pin holes, the fixed pins are arranged as the ends of the miniature gravity sensors, the operation tool can be taken down and an operation link can be entered only by pressing through the metal flat washers in the middle sections of the ends, the buckles are arranged beside each fixed pin and are opened after multiple verification through the safety monitoring system, the safety monitoring system comprises a fingerprint machine 14, a voice broadcaster 15, a gravity sensor signal box 16, a temperature hygrometer 17, a rainwater sensor 18, a wind anemoscope 19 and a remote computer 20, wherein the fingerprint machine 14 records the fingerprint information and the work number of all personnel with the qualification of gas operation, the remote computer records the work number of the gas operation personnel and the information of the personnel operating the work number, four fixing pins 6 are arranged and connected with the gravity sensor signal box 16, and a multichannel analog transmitter in the gravity sensor signal box 16 converts the mV differential signal of the sensor into 4-20mA output analog signals to simulate the operation of 4-20mA The signals are uploaded through an RS485/RS232 interface; the temperature and humidity meter 17 is composed of a thermometer and a humidity meter, the rainwater sensor 18 is made of a double-sided material, plated with nickel on the surface, resistant to oxidation and electricity, and outputs and detects whether rain exists by adopting a DO TTL switch signal: when no raindrop exists on the induction plate, the DO output is high level, when raindrop exists, the DO output is low level, the rain sensor 18 and the humidity condition in the temperature and humidity meter 17 jointly judge whether the weather is rainy, and information collected by an environmental thermometer attached to the safety system is brought into a lock opening condition (high-temperature operation is limited, and reminding is broadcasted); information collected by a hygrometer and a rainwater sensor attached to the safety system is brought into a lock catch opening condition (gas operation in rainy days is limited, and reminding is broadcasted); the remote computer of the safety system judges whether two fingerprints are the same person or not, safety regulations of not less than 2 persons are met in rigid matching gas operation, a timer, a voice broadcaster, a gravity sensor, a buckle and other common constraint operation tools of the remote computer of the safety system are fixedly arranged, and after the gas operation is completely finished, a safety monitoring system collects parameters such as ambient temperature, humidity, wind power, violation of regulations and the like, and stores and prints all operation information. The novel glasses valve operation tool 5 is made of brass, sparks cannot be generated when the novel glasses valve operation tool is in contact with an iron pipe valve during operation, one side of each of two ends of the operation tool is bent inwards for 30 degrees, the other side of each of the two ends of the operation tool is bent outwards for 30 degrees, any one end of the operation tool 5 is inserted into a pipe of the T-shaped stress bar 4, the glasses valve fastening bolt operation can be carried out, the T-shaped stress bar 4 is formed by welding two sections of stainless steel pipes, three sets of T-shaped stress bars 4 are needed after full-weld forming, the T-shaped stress bars 4 are connected with the fastening bolts 3 through a thermal expansion method and become a new operation end, the T-shaped stress bars 4 are of T-shaped structures, and the operation angle is increased to 360 degrees when the T-shaped stress bars are matched with the new operation tool 5 for use. The working angle of the tool is far more than that of a conventional tool, and the working efficiency is obviously improved. The end head bulge of the novel glasses valve operating tool 5 is of a triangular key structure and is used for opening a triangular lock on a protection box 9 on the outer side of a nitrogen purging ball valve 8 on site, and then the nitrogen purging ball valve can be opened, closed and adjusted. The body system of operating means 5 has 2 pinholes, and fixed pin 6 is gravity sensor's original paper, and its middle part welding has stainless steel flat packing ring 7, forms wholly, operating means 5 can fix a position through 2 body pinholes and put on the sub-assembly of fixed pin 6 and 7. The fixed pin 6 totally is four, and the lower extreme is fixed at four on-the-spot position through threaded connection's mode, and the bottom of fixed pin 6 has signal transmission line to be connected with gravity sensor signal box 16, the edge of fixed pin 6 is the buckle, and the logic that matches safety system 12 just can open to control and restraint operating means 5's use.

The working process is as follows: referring to fig. 1-8, the two new operating tools 5 are positioned at specific locations on site, and the tools are painted with red and white paint, i.e., on-site warnings. Before the operation tool 5 is taken, the gas operation qualification fingerprint identification is carried out according to the fingerprint machine 14; if the recognition result is 'N', the fingerprint machine takes a picture by a camera and retains the picture; if the identification result is Y, entering next shift identification; and if the shift identification result is 'N', the personnel information is stored, and if the shift identification result is 'Y', the environment temperature judgment link is entered.

The ambient temperature judges the link, if the recognition result is "N" (ambient temperature is higher than 37 ℃), then 15 vocalizations of voice broadcast ware: the operation against traffic! "the flow ends. And if the identification result is Y, entering a humidity and rainwater judgment link.

In the humidity and rainwater judgment link, only if the humidity mean value of the temperature and humidity meter 17 is more than 70% within half an hour and the rainwater sensor 18 detects raindrops, the judgment is made as a rainy day (Y), and at the moment, the buckle 13-1 and the buckle 13-2 in the four tool buckles 13 are opened; if the recognition result is "N", 15 vocalizations of voice broadcast ware: the operation against traffic! "the flow ends.

When the buckle 13-1 and the buckle 13-2 are opened, the coal gas safety regulation identification is carried out: remote computer 20 judges whether the fingerprint of opening instrument buckle 13-1 and buckle 13-2 belongs to the same person, if the recognition result is "Y", confirm to the same person, then 15 vocalizations of voice broadcast ware: the operation against traffic! "save the piece of information at the same time. If the recognition result is 'N', the buckle 13-3 and the buckle 13-4 are opened only when different operators are confirmed, and the safety regulations of not less than 2 persons for gas operation are matched rigidly.

When the buckle 13-3 and the buckle 13-4 are opened, the remote computer 20 sends an instruction to enable the gravity sensor signal box 16 to enter an electrified state, so that whether the operation tool 5 is taken down or not can be judged, the countdown of the timer of the remote computer 20 is started, within 30 minutes, the fixing pin 6 (gravity sensor) detects that the two operation tools 5 are reset, and the four buckles 13 are reset, so that the remote computer 20 judges that: tool reset ("Y"), voice announcer 15 sounds: "you are painstaking! "if the judged result is" N ", 15 vocalizations of voice broadcast ware: the operation against traffic! ", and save the information.

When the tool is reset (Y) in the process, the remote computer 20 sends an instruction to enable the gravity sensor signal box 16 to enter a power-off state, simultaneously collects data of the temperature and humidity meter 17 and the wind direction indicator 19, summarizes and stores the data and information of gas operators, operation duration, violation of regulations and the like recorded in the remote computer 20, and prints all operation information during the gas operation at one time.
